
Salary expectations at Hvanneyri Agricultural University, located in Iceland, are typically determined by a combination of factors including role, academic rank, years of experience, and field of expertise. As a public institution, the university often adheres to standardized pay scales set by the Icelandic government or relevant unions for academic and administrative staff. While specific salary bands are not always publicly disclosed in detail, transparency is generally maintained through collective bargaining agreements and public sector guidelines. Employees may also receive additional compensation based on research grants, teaching load, or administrative responsibilities.
In general, salaries at Hvanneyri Agricultural University are competitive within the Icelandic public sector, reflecting the country’s high cost of living and strong labor protections. Pay progression is often tied to tenure, academic performance, and contributions to the university’s mission in agricultural and environmental sciences. As a smaller institution, salary structures may be less complex compared to larger universities, but they are benchmarked against national standards for higher education. For the most accurate and up-to-date figures, prospective employees are encouraged to consult official university or governmental resources, as public data may not always reflect recent adjustments or individual circumstances.
